Some Diabetes Medications

Example: Metformin in patients with pre-existing kidney issues.

Risk of lactic acidosis if kidneys are compromised.

Contrast Agents in Imaging Tests

Used in CT scans or X-rays.

Can cause contrast-induced nephropathy in vulnerable patients.

Painkillers Containing Acetaminophen (Paracetamol)

Overuse can lead to kidney damage over time.
